Stock Market Holiday: NSE, BSE shut today on account of Lok Sabha Elections

Stock Market Holiday: Due to the Lok Sabha elections in Mumbai, the National Stock Exchange (NSE) and the Bombay Stock Exchange (BSE) will be closed today, Monday, May 20, in accordance with the BSE’s market holiday calendar. The SLB, derivative, and equity divisions, among others, will all be closed today. The Multi-Commodity Exchange (MCX) will…
